E-mil: grzechu272@gmil.com Puerty nd reproduction, crucil events in the life history of ll nimls, re controlled y environmentl fctors (temperture, photoperiod) s well s endogenous fctors such s hormones, neurohormones, neurotrnsmitters or steroids (ZOHR et l. 2010). In fish, gond mturtion (ended y spermition or ovultion) is regulted y the hypothlmopituitry-gondl (HPG) xis. mjor role in this process is plyed y gondolierin (GnRH) produced in the hypothlmus. GnRH controls the relese of gondotropins (LH nd FSH) from the pituitry glnd (PETER & YU 1997; YU et l. 1997). Gondotropins ct on gonds to stimulte the synthesis of sex steroid hormones nd gondl development. Sex steroids ffect GnRH nd gondotropin relese y positive or negtive feedck effects depending on the stge of gond mturity (CRIM & EVNS 1983; TRUDEU 1997; ROU et l. 2007). In mny fish species, the dopminergic system is responsile for inhiition of GnRH nd LH secretion (KEIN & CLNE 1979; CRDINUD et l. 1998; NIEUWENHUYS et l. 1998). It ws shown tht the strength of dopmine (D) inhiition on LH secretion differs etween species nd could depend on the stge of gond mturity nd seson (SOKOLOWSK et l. 1985; PETER et l. 1991). Strong dopmine inhiition ws oserved in juvenile eel in which D is puerty gtekeeper. In cyprinids wek inhiitory effect of D ws oserved during the initil stge of gmetogenesis nd strong inhiition ws found during the pre-ovultory LH surge nd ovultion (SOKOLOWSK et l. 1985; VIDL et l. 2004; PRK et l. 2007). *Supported y Ntionl Science Centre grnt numer DEC-2011/01/N/NZ4/01159 nd DS-3202/KiIR.

2 26 G. GOSIEWSKI et l. The discovery of kisspeptin in 2001 (KOTNI et l. 2001; MUIR et l. 2001; OHTKI et l. 2001) incresed our knowledge of endocrine control of puerty nd mturtion. Kisspeptin is neurohormone controlling the HPG xis vi the GnRH system in ll vertertes, including fish (MESSGER et l. 2005; VN ERLE et l. 2008; ZOHR et l. 2010; TEN-SEMPERE 2012; MECHLY et l. 2013; OGW & PRHR 2013). Injections of kisspeptin increse LH secretion in goldfish, Crssius urtus (LI et l. 2009), Europen se ss, Dicentrrchus lrx (FELIP et l. 2009), Yellowtil Kingfish, Seriol llndi (NOCILLDO et l. 2012) nd Striped ss, Morone sxtilis (ECK et l. 2012; ZMOR et l. 2012). lso, in vitro studies demonstrte the ility of kisspeptins to induce LH relese from cultured pituitry cells (YNG et l. 2010; CHNG et l. 2012). Moreover, it ws shown tht kisspeptin is le to modulte ctivity of the HPG xis; therefore kisspeptin my ply role s puerty gtekeeper in juvenile eel (PSQUIER et l. 2011). Kisspeptin receptor expression ws loclized close to GnRH neurons in cichlid fish (PRHR et l. 2004) nd ws greter in fish which were t the eginning of puerty thn t pre- nd postpuerty stges. These results demonstrted tht GnRH cells re direct trgets for kisspeptin in fish nd tht kisspeptin induces GnRH relese, s lredy shown in mmmls (DHILLO et l. 2005, 2007; MESSGER et l. 2005; PLNT et l. 2006; CRTY & FRNCESCHINI 2008). lso, dopmine ffects LH relese in juvenile fish (VIDL et l. 2004; PRK et l. 2007) which is very well documented t the time of finl mturtion (ovultion nd spermition) (OMELJNIUK et l. 1989; DULK et l. 1992; TRUDEU et l. 1993; TRUDEU 1997). Since the reltion etween GnRH nd dopmine s well s etween GnRH nd kisspeptin systems hs een demonstrted in fish, the crucil prolem is the existence of possile reltionship etween kisspeptin nd the dopminergic system. ccording to our knowledge there is no dt showing direct reltionship etween these two systems in fish: however in experiments conducted on ewes it ws shown tht interction etween kisspeptin nd dopmine is involved in sesonl chnges in reproductive function, mesured y the vrition in GnRH nd LH secretion (GOODMN et l. 2012). lso, in mice it ws demonstrted tht one of the su-popultions of kisspeptin neurons is responsile for synthesizing D nd projecting it to GnRH neurons (CLRKSON & HERISON 2011). Therefore the im of our experiments ws to exmine the effects of kisspeptin on spontneous nd GnRH-stimulted LH relese in Prussin crp (Crssius gielio loch, 1782) with ctive nd locked dopminergic systems t different stges of gond development. Mteril nd Methods ll experiments were pproved y the First Locl Ethicl Committee on niml Testing in Krków 41/2011. Fish were collected from the ponds of the Fisheries Reserch Sttion of the University of griculture in Krków. Two yer old femles of Crssius gielio of verge ody weight (.w.) 83 ± 17 g nd gondosomtic index (GSI) (4.30 ± 2.06 % stge of gond recrudescence; ± 3.47 % mture fish) were trnsferred to glss tnks with erted wter. fter 2 dys of cclimtistion to experimentl conditions fish were divided into 8 groups of 14 nimls ech. During the winter experiment (Jnury) wter temperture ws 12±1 C nd winter photoperiod (L:D = 8:16) ws mintined, wheres during summer experiments (My) wter temperture ws 20±1 C nd summer photoperiod (L:D = 16:8) ws estlished. In oth sesons, fish were given intrperitonel (ip) injections of metstin (45-54) mide, humn (Sigm-ldrich, US) kisspeptin (KISS1) t dose of 0.1 mg kg -1 of.w.; pimozide (Pim) (Sigm-ldrich, US) dopmine ntgonist t dose of 5 mg kg 1 of.w. nd (Des Gly 10, D-l 6 ethylmide) LH-RH (Sigm-ldrich, US) GnRH nlogue (GnRH-) t dose of 20 g kg -1 of.w. lone or in comintions. Drugs were dissolved in 0.6 % sline solution (KISS1 nd GnRH-) or soluilized in cidified ethylene glycol (pimozide). Smples of lood (200 l) were collected from cudl veins of ech fish with the use of heprinized syringes efore injection (time 0) nd 3, 6, 12 or 24 hours fter injection. For plsm seprtion smples were centrifuged for 3 minutes t g. LH levels were mesured in plsm with the use of the enzyme-linked immunosorent ssy method ELIS (KH et l.1989). The otined LH concentrtions were nlysed using GrphPd Prism sttisticl softwre (version 5 GrphPd Softwre, US). ll dt were expressed s the percent of pre-tretment vlue (mesured t time 0) nd presented s men ± SEM. nonprmetric Mnn-Whitney test (U-test) with onferroni correction ws performed. Differences etween groups were considered significnt t P<0.05. Numer of fish per group: n = 14. Discussion To dte, most of the evidence for the role of kisspeptins in the onset of puerty nd the ctivtion of the HP xis in fish comes from gene expression nlyses. There re however, studies showing tht in vivo exogenous kisspeptin dministrtion ccelertes gondl development (ECK et l. 2012; ZMOR et l. 2012). The mechnism nd the site of ction (hypothlmus nd/or pituitry glnd) in this process re not well known. There re dt showing tht kisspeptin induces GnRH relese from the hypothlmus nd lso cts directly t the pituitry (NOCILLDO et l. 2007; YNG et l. 2010; ZOHR et l. 2010; CHNG et l. 2012). ccording to our knowledge there is no informtion on the interction of kisspeptin with other systems except for GnRH involved in the control of LH secretion, especilly with the dopminergic pthwy hving crucil role in gondotropin relese inhiition in fish. In our experiments on Prussin crp, intrperitonel injections of humn kisspeptin t dose of 0.1 mg kg -1.w. showed no effect of KISS1 on the spontneous secretion of LH, neither in mture nor recrudescing nimls (Fig. 1) despite the fct tht

6 30 G. GOSIEWSKI et l. erlier pilot experiments demonstrted tht kisspeptin (t 0.01 nd 0.1 mg kg -1.w.) significntly stimulted spontneous secretion of LH in fish with gonds t the stge of recrudescence (dt not shown). full explntion of this lck of response in the present study in comprison to erlier tested doses of this hormone is not possile t the moment nd hopefully the next series of experiments will confirm the ility of this type of kisspeptin to ffect spontneous gondotropin relese in Prussin crp. comprehensive ssessment of the effects of different kisspeptins on LH secretion in fish is not possile ecuse only limited dt from in vivo experiments re ville. Existing results showed tht different kisspeptins ffected some elements of the HP xis: stimultion of LH relese y goldfish kisspeptin 1 ws oserved y LI et l. (2009) or incresed expression of kiss1r coding gene in fthed minnow y mmmlin kisspeptin (FILY et l. 2008). Humn kisspeptin, used in our experiments, could hve lower ility to stimulte LH secretion in Prussin crp thn the species-specific peptide, possily cusing the non-significnt effect on spontneous LH relese. ccording to our knowledge there is no other dt on the use of humn kisspeptin in fish. dmittedly, chnges of the spontneous relese of LH under the influence of humn kisspeptin were not demonstrted in oth tested sesons ut yet n dditive effect of kisspeptin nd GnRH- on LH relese ws found: 12 hours fter injection of oth hormones, LH concentrtions were significntly higher in comprison to the control while GnRH- or kisspeptin given lone hd no sttisticlly significnt effect on LH secretion (Fig. 1). The stimultory effect of KISS1+GnRH- on LH relese ws oserved in mture fish s well s in those with recrudescing gonds nd the only difference ws tht in recrudescent fish this dditive effect lsted longer, up to 24 hours fter injection. It should e noted tht GnRH- given lone stimulted significnt LH relese in oth sesons, ut this stimultion ws oserved only up to 6 hours post-injection (Fig. 1). From the dt otined in mmmls or in fish it is cler tht kisspeptin my ffect LH secretion directly, t the pituitry level (GUTIÉRREZ-PSCUEL et l. 2007; SUZUKI et l. 2008; YNG et l. 2010; CHNG et l. 2012) s well s indirectly, vi other hypothlmic fctors, such s the GnRH system (IRWIG et l. 2004; MESSGER et l. 2005; ZOHR et l. 2010; TEN-SEMPERE 2012; MECHLY et l. 2013; OGW & PRHR 2013). In our experiments (oth sesons) the potentiting effect of kisspeptin on GnRH- ction ws lso found: LH levels in groups receiving oth drugs were significntly higher thn in fish treted only with GnRH-, t 12 hours in mture fish or t 24 hours t the time of gond recrudescence (Fig. 1). sed on our results we cnnot explin t which level (hypothlmic or pituitry) this potentition occurred. Interestingly, this potentition ws found regrdless of the seson: in oth mture nd recrudescent fish the secretion of gondotropin, expressed s the percent of pretretment, ws very similr nd the differences etween sesons were smll, which is quite unusul ecuse the sesonlity of the reproductive xis sensitivity to hormonl tretment is well recognized in fish (CHNG & PETER 1983; SOKOLOWSK et l. 1985; PETER et l. 1986; PETER 1991; KIM et l. 2011). To test the possiility of indirect ction of kisspeptin on LH secretion, i.e., vi different pthwy thn the GnRH system, pimozide (dopmine receptor ntgonist) ws dministered to Prussin crp receiving kisspeptin. Extremely strong stimultion of LH relese (Fig. 2), s consequence of locking of D receptors, ws shown during spwning seson. Pimozide given lone evoked lmost n 8-fold increse of LH secretion, lsting up to 24 hours, when compred to the control group. This response ws even stronger thn to GnRH- lone (Fig. 1). The dt on fish (CHNG & PETER 1983; SOKOLOWSK et l. 1985; PETER et l. 1986; SOKOLOWSK-MIKOLJCZYK et l. 2002; 2002) show tht differentil response of LH secretion to exogenous drugs or hormones (pimozide, GnRH nlogues) exists t different stges of gond mturity: usully weker effects re oserved t the time of gond recrudescence. This ws not the cse in the present investigtion. This oservtion is indirectly supported y findings otined in mmmls. SZWK et l. (2010) demonstrted tht kisspeptin inhiited D neurons in ovriectomized (OVX) rts treted with estrdiol (E2). Moreover, the comintion of pimozide nd kisspeptin cused strong stimultion of LH relese in comprison to the control group, especilly evident in mture fish (Fig. 2). This ws likely due to the strong ction of pimozide lone. In recrudescent fish this stimultion t 24 hours post injection ws two-fold higher thn in fish receiving only pimozide, showing tht kisspeptin ws le to still potentite the LH relesing ility of pimozide despite its strong ction. ecuse such n effect ws found in recrudescent fish only, it my suggest tht kisspeptin is more importnt for ccelertion of the mturtion process in the new seson thn for finl oocyte mturtion. The fct tht kisspeptin cn potentite the stimultory effects of GnRH- or pimozide on LH secretion ut t the sme time ws not effective when given lone, my suggest tht the ction of humn kisspeptin is rther indirect, through the dopminergic system. The elimintion or diminution of do-

7 Humn Kisspeptin in Fish Reproduction 31 pmine inhiition on LH secretion y pimozide is sometimes crucil to demonstrte the potentil of other hormones involved in gondotropin secretion regultion in fish (PETER et l. 1986). In the conditions of our experiment this reduction enled kisspeptin, inctive when given lone, to mrk its stimultory potentil in the control of LH relese (significntly importnt stimultion of KISS1 dministered with pimozide in comprison to pimozide lone). However, in the cse of the comined tretment with GnRH- nd kisspeptin in fish with locked dopminergic system y pimozide, the response to kisspeptin ws reversed: t 6 hours post tretment in recrudescent fish sttisticlly significnt reduction of LH secretion ws oserved when compred with pimozide nd GnRH- injected fish (Fig. 3). sed on our results it is not possile to explin this chnge in the direction of kisspeptin ction on LH relese, especilly since kisspeptin cts in vertertes (lso in fish) s centrl processor/meditor of severl inputs including photoperiod, energy lnce sttus of the orgnism or steroid hormone feedck nd the finl LH secretion is the result of the response to ll these fctors (DUNGN et l. 2006; ZMOR et l. 2012). ccording to our knowledge there is no evidence on dopmine nd kisspeptin interction in GnRH (nd LH) relese in fish, however the reltionships etween kisspeptin nd GnRH nd lso etween dopmine nd GnRH (nd LH) were lredy estlished (see Introduction) which is why dopmine involvement in these processes (dopminekisspeptin-gnrh ) is highly likely. esides the inhiitory ction of kisspeptin on D neurons (SZWK et l. 2010), there is informtion tht in mmmls (nestrous ewes) dopminergic neurons ct vi kisspeptin neurons to inhiit GnRH (nd LH) secretion (GOODMN et l. 2010; 2012). lso, in mice, CLRKSON nd HERISON (2011) descried supopultion of kisspeptin neurons synthesizing dopmine nd projecting to GnRH neurons. It is possile then tht in fish, kisspeptin neurons my integrte mny hormonl nd environmentl signls nd tht dopmine inhiition on GnRH relese is prtly direct (t the level of GnRH producing neurons) nd prtly indirect through diminution of stimultory ction of kisspeptin on LH secreting cells. Our results re still preliminry nd need to e verified y further in vivo nd lso in vitro experiments.
